My two cents on the box jumps....box jumps might useful for a warm up or something, some small utility. But as far as transfer to dropping under a clean or snatch...idk...tallish box jumps you always jump forward to some degree, people usually curl their lumbar a little going up to the box...land in a little bit of a fetal position. Cleans you land with your back vertical, chest up. On paper they seem similar, but really going under the bar has a real different feel to it. The jump is different too the way and timing of extending your hips. I'd be careful with those.
I could see maybe doing box jumps to a short box just to work on explosiveness (short=you can put it close in front of you, don't have to jump out to it).
